The Maharashtra Anti- Terror Squad arrested a Kolkata- based man for allegedly making threat calls to Maharashtra Chief Minister Uddhav Thackeray, Shiv Sena leader Sanjay Raut, state’s Home Minister Anil Deshmukh and NCP chief Sharad Pawar. According to the reports, the accused Palash Bose projected himself as a member of the notorious Dawood Ibrahim gang and made threat calls from international mobile numbers.

The accused, unhappy with the Maharashtra government’s stand on the Sushant Singh Rajput case, allegedly made threat calls from international mobile numbers to various state political leaders. He also dialled Thackeray’s residence ‘Matoshree’ and Sharad Pawar’s residence ‘Silver Oak’ to issue threats.

He was arrested by encounter specialist Daya Nayak’s team in Kolkata and was later brought to Mumbai. As per the reports, Palash was working in Kolkata as a fitness trainer and had returned to the city two years ago after spending 17 years in Dubai where he was working in a club.
